Why alcohol detox is entitled to careful attention

Alcohol withdrawal can look mild in a single person and serious in another. 2 people may report alcohol consumption about the very same quantity, yet one can stop with outpatient assistance while the other establishes hazardous signs within hours. The difference typically boils down to aspects that are easy to miss without a clinical evaluation: prior withdrawal history, age, liver function, other drugs, co-occurring stress and anxiety, nutrition, and whether the person has been consuming alcohol around the clock or mainly in the evenings.

A detail numerous households do not recognize is that withdrawal severity can escalate gradually. A person who got through it by themselves once may not have the very same experience the next time. Medical professionals occasionally describe this pattern as an aggravating level of sensitivity of the nervous system. In plain terms, the body becomes less flexible. That is one reason experienced suppliers take a background of previous detox attempts seriously.

The very first stage of alcohol detox is frequently noted by trembling, sweating, anxiety, queasiness, poor rest, elevated heart price, and irritability. In more serious cases, people can create seizures, hallucinations, serious complication, or a lethal syndrome called ecstasy tremens. Not every person goes to risk for the most unsafe difficulties, yet it is impossible to predict safely without appropriate screening.

This is where the expression alcohol detox can obtain misinterpreted. Some therapy centers use it loosely. A real detox program must include medical oversight, not simply a silent area and inspiration. The degree of tracking may vary, however the factor is that experienced specialists are evaluating signs and symptoms, seeing crucial indicators, handling complications, and changing care as the person stabilizes.

What clinical detox really looks like

A well-run detoxification typically starts with a consumption analysis. Personnel will ask about how much and exactly how commonly the person beverages, the last time they consumed alcohol, whether they have actually ever had withdrawal seizures or hallucinations, and what other materials are entailed. They will certainly likewise examine medical history, drugs, mental health and wellness problems, and standard safety issues such as loss threat and suicidality.

Then comes energetic administration. In most cases, medical professionals use medications to lower withdrawal symptoms and lower the risk of difficulties. The specific program depends on the setting and the person. Some people need close observation over several days. Others can be treated in a less intensive setting if they have light signs, strong support in the house, and no red flags. Hydration, nutrition, rest, and thiamine substitute typically matter greater than households realize, particularly for lasting problem drinkers who have actually not been eating well.

A point worth stressing is that detoxification is brief. It may last a couple of days, in some cases a bit much longer. By the end, the body is more secure, however the dependency is not solved. Yearnings usually proceed. Mood can dip sharply after the preliminary situation. Rest may stay interfered with for weeks. That is why the handoff from alcohol detox to alcohol rehab or ongoing alcohol addiction treatment is one of one of the most essential shifts in recuperation care. When individuals end up detox and go home with no follow-up strategy, regression prices are high.

When detox ought to never be a solo project

Some individuals attempt to quit on their own due to the fact that they are embarrassed, anxious concerning price, or encouraged they ought to be able to manage it privately. That impulse is easy to understand. It is also high-risk when particular indication are present.

  • A history of withdrawal seizures, hallucinations, or delirium
  • Drinking from morning to evening, or requiring alcohol to quit shaking
  • Significant clinical issues, especially liver disease, cardiovascular disease, or unrestrained diabetes
  • Recent use various other sedating substances such as benzodiazepines
  • Severe anxiety, self-destructive thoughts, or a harmful home environment

Any one of those can tip the balance toward medical detoxification as opposed to self-managed withdrawal. In the real world, numerous commonly turn up together. A middle-aged individual could have high blood pressure, bad nutrition, hidden benzodiazepine usage, and a partner that functions evenings. Theoretically, each concern can appear workable. Incorporated, they alter the risk account substantially.

Detox, rehab, and therapy are not interchangeable

Families typically use alcohol detox, alcohol rehab, and alcohol addiction treatment as if they mean the very same thing. They overlap, however each points to a different component of care.

Detox is the brief clinical phase of getting alcohol out of the system securely. Alcohol rehab normally describes structured therapy after detoxification, frequently inpatient or residential, though some individuals make use of the term more broadly. Alcoholism treatment is the umbrella term that covers detox, rehab, outpatient care, therapy, medicine, relapse prevention, and lasting recuperation support.

This difference issues since many individuals enter treatment assuming detox is the finish line. A person can complete detox and still have the same stress factors, routines, trauma sets off, and reward pathways that drove the drinking. In the very first week after detox, inspiration might be high. By week three, rest deprivation, embarassment, monotony, or household problem can strike hard. A strong therapy plan prepares for that.

For some patients, the ideal following action is domestic alcohol rehab, where the structure is tight and outdoors interruptions are minimized. For others, a partial a hospital stay or extensive outpatient program makes even more feeling because they have stable housing, job responsibilities, and a safe assistance network. There is no virtue in choosing the highest level of treatment if a lower one will function, and there is no financial savings in selecting a reduced degree if it causes repeated regression and dilemma care.

Who often tends to do well in outpatient care, and that frequently needs more structure

Outpatient therapy can be really efficient, specifically when the drinking problem is moderate, the home environment is steady, and the person is really ready to take part. A person with a consistent routine, household support, no considerable withdrawal history, and a solid factor to recoup can do extremely well in extensive outpatient care paired with medicine and therapy.

Residential or inpatient alcohol rehab is usually a far better fit when the setting in the house is disorderly or saturated with triggers. If the fridge contains beer, debates are continuous, or pals visit every evening anticipating to consume, the possibility of very early relapse increases sharply. The very same is true for people with repeated stopped working outpatient efforts, extreme co-occurring psychological wellness signs, or a pattern of leaving detox and drinking within days.

I have seen individuals pick outpatient care because it looked less disruptive, just to invest the next month missing sessions, hiding alcohol use, and winding up back in withdrawal. I have additionally seen individuals insist they required inpatient rehabilitation when what they really needed was competent outpatient therapy, medication assistance, and household borders in your home. The right answer is hardly ever ideological. It is clinical and practical.

The treatments and sustains that issue after detox

Once the severe withdrawal period finishes, treatment changes from stablizing to change. This is where quality differs widely. A sleek site can make every program seem the very same, but the everyday experience often discloses whether a center recognizes recuperation past slogans.

Good alcoholism treatment typically includes private counseling, group job, regression prevention preparation, and some kind of psychological health and wellness analysis. Many individuals that consume alcohol heavily are also dealing with trauma, panic, clinical depression, pain, persistent pain, or historical rest issues. If those issues go untreated, alcohol typically hurries back in as a quick, acquainted coping tool.

Medication can also play a meaningful duty after detox. Some individuals benefit from medicines that minimize desires or make drinking less fulfilling. Others require treatment for clinical depression or anxiety when medical professionals can distinguish those signs and symptoms from intense withdrawal. Drug is not a shortcut or an indication that someone is not striving enough. For the right patient, it can reduce the temperature level of the entire process and produce room for treatment to work.

Family participation is an additional location where solid programs divide themselves. Loved ones require education and learning, not just peace of mind. They ought to understand what early recovery resembles, just how to spot real threat, and why enabling can quietly undermine therapy. At the same time, family treatment must not develop into a blame session. The objective is to produce clearer assumptions, safer communication, and a practical recovery environment.

How to evaluate an alcohol rehab in Albuquerque

There is no excellent facility, yet there are clear signs of capability. You can find out a good deal from the very first phone call. Notification whether team ask thoughtful concerns or merely attempt to schedule a bed. Notice whether they talk about medical history, insurance, medicines, and withdrawal risk, or whether whatever sounds unusually easy.

Here are a couple of concerns worth asking when contrasting alcohol rehab Albuquerque alternatives:

  • Do you supply clinical detox on site, or do you refer out for detox?
  • How do you decide in between inpatient, residential, and outpatient treatment?
  • What is your prepare for patients with anxiousness, anxiety, trauma, or various other psychological wellness needs?
  • What takes place after discharge, and how do you sustain relapse prevention?
  • Which insurance coverage plans do you work with, and what costs need to we expect?

A credible program must respond to directly. If actions remain unclear, or if every individual somehow requires the same bundle of care, beware. Therapy preparation need to seem customized, due to the fact that reliable care is.

What early healing usually feels like, and why that matters

Many people expect immediate alleviation after they quit consuming. Some do feel better swiftly, especially https://www.tumblr.com/ascendreccenternm physically. Others really feel worse prior to they really feel much better. Sleep can stay fragmented. Power might be low. Stress and anxiety can flare at sundown, the old alcohol consumption hour. Psychological feeling numb lifts, and what follows is not constantly enjoyable. Pity, pain, impatience, and boredom can all surge in the initial month.

This is where experience in alcohol rehab matters. Programs that prepare clients for the irregular rhythm of very early recovery tend to retain them much better. Patients need to listen to that a harsh third week does not indicate treatment is falling short. It typically implies the mind is altering and the individual is encountering real life without alcohol as a buffer.

Practical planning aids greater than inspirational language right here. What will the person do after work at 6:30 p.m.? Exactly how will they handle the first wedding celebration, football event, or lonely weekend? That are they intended to call when the desire spikes and they are currently in the car park of a liquor shop? Healing strategies ought to answer those concerns in ordinary terms.

The role of relapse in therapy planning

Relapse is common in alcohol usage disorder, yet it ought to not be treated as inescapable or trivial. An excellent program takes it seriously without turning it right into ethical failure. The helpful concern is not simply, "Did the person drink once more?" It is, "What sequence led there, and what has to transform currently?"

Sometimes the response is level of treatment. A client might have left treatment too early or mosted likely to outpatient care when property therapy was more appropriate. In some cases the answer is psychiatric treatment. Untreated panic attacks at bedtime can become a straight path back to alcohol. Occasionally it is ecological. I have seen patients materialize progression in treatment, then return home to a companion who consumes greatly and buffoons soberness. That is not a little obstacle. It is a central treatment issue.

Relapse needs to trigger reassessment, not resignation. If the initial plan was insufficient, the repair is to reinforce the plan.

How long does alcohol detox take in Albuquerque?

Alcohol det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days, although the timeline varies by individual. Factors such as drinking history, overall health, and withdrawal severity influence the duration. Symptoms often begin within hours after the last drink and peak within 24 to 72 hours. Some mild symptoms may continue for several weeks.

What are the symptoms of alcohol withdrawal in Albuquerque?

Common alcohol withdrawal symptoms include anxiety, tremors, sweating, nausea, headaches, and insomnia. More severe symptoms can include hallucinations, seizures, and delirium tremens. Symptoms usually begin within 6 to 24 hours after stopping alcohol use. Severity depends on the level and duration of alcohol consumption.

How long do alcohol withdrawal symptoms last in Albuquerque?

Most alcohol withdrawal symptoms begin within the first day after stopping drinking and peak within 72 hours. Mild symptoms often improve within 5 to 7 days. Some individuals experience prolonged symptoms, such as sleep disturbances or anxiety, for weeks or months. The duration varies based on individual health and drinking patterns.

What medications are used during alcohol detox in Albuquerque?

Medications used during alcohol detox often include benzodiazepines to help prevent seizures and reduce withdrawal symptoms. Other medications may be prescribed to manage anxiety, nausea, sleep disturbances, or cravings. Vitamin supplements, particularly thiamine, are commonly provided to address nutritional deficiencies. Medication choices depend on the individual's symptoms and medical needs.
